技术文摘
Git 代码防丢秘籍
Git 代码防丢秘籍
在软件开发的世界里,代码就是开发者的心血结晶。然而,代码丢失的风险始终存在,可能是由于硬件故障、误操作、版本冲突等原因。为了确保您的 Git 代码安全无虞,以下是一些关键的秘籍。
定期进行本地和远程的代码提交是至关重要的。不要等到完成了一个大型功能才提交,而是将代码的修改分成有逻辑的小块,并及时推送到远程仓库。这样,即使本地出现问题,您在远程仓库中仍有最新的备份。
为您的 Git 仓库设置清晰的分支策略。常见的分支策略如主分支(master 或 main)用于稳定的可发布代码,开发分支(development)用于集成新功能,以及针对每个特定功能或修复的特性分支。这样可以避免不同开发工作之间的冲突,并且在出现问题时能够快速定位和回滚。
配置好.gitignore 文件。这个文件可以指定哪些文件和文件夹不需要被 Git 跟踪,比如临时文件、编译生成的文件或者包含敏感信息的文件。这样可以减少不必要的代码存储,提高仓库的整洁度和性能。
另外,使用 Git 的标签(tag)功能来标记重要的版本。例如,发布版本、里程碑版本等。这有助于在需要回滚或者查找特定版本时能够快速准确地定位。
与团队成员保持良好的沟通和协作。在合并代码前,仔细审查他人的更改,并且在合并过程中解决可能出现的冲突。
还有一点容易被忽视,那就是定期对远程仓库进行备份。虽然 Git 本身具有分布式的特点,但额外的备份可以提供额外的保障。
最后,了解并熟练使用 Git 的恢复命令和工具。例如,git reflog 可以查看操作的历史记录,帮助您找回意外丢失的更改。
通过遵循以上秘籍,您可以大大降低 Git 代码丢失的风险,让您的开发工作更加安心和高效。保护好代码,就是保护好您的劳动成果和团队的智慧结晶。
- SQL 中 Group By 用法全面梳理及多字段限制解析
- Yaf安装、rewrite规则配置及最简单Yaf项目生成
- SQL 数据库语句优化剖析与技巧汇总:借助 SQL 优化工具
- mysql 下载安装教程:如何下载并安装 mysql
- MySQL 数据库零基础快速入门经典教程
- mysql图形化管理工具推荐与排行
- mysql count查询速度慢如何解决?mysql查询速度优化策略
- MySQL 有哪些数据类型?深度解析 MySQL 数据类型
- MySQL类型转换引发行锁升级为表锁
- MySQL 利用备份与 binlog 恢复误删除数据操作
- MySQL实例:添加账户、授予权限与删除用户全流程解析
- 在 Mac 系统通过终端进行 MySQL 数据库管理
- 基于 JAVA 的数据库部分知识操作代码
- MySQL数据库第一章剖析:MySQL架构与历史
- MySQL数据库第二章解读之MySQL基准测试